Electromotor for machine

I had a choice of several engines, but the electric motor that stood on a tile cutting machine was a more suitable cover. To some extent, work on the machine was like an experiment, because I was not confident in sufficient motor power. Therefore, I stopped on a modular solution with a frame for a ribbon mechanism as a single element that can be removed and rearranged on a more powerful foundation. The speed of rotation of the motor quite satisfied me, but bothered that 6 and give weak power. After a small test, I saw that for simple work this electric motor approached, but for more intensive work, you need to choose something more powerful. When designing your machine, pay attention to this moment.

As I mentioned, the casing at the electric motor was very suitable, as it allowed to create a vertical machine that will easily move.

First you need to free it up, removing the desktop, saw, protection, pallet for water, leaving only the electric motor. Another advantage of using this motor was a threaded core and a nut for fixing the saw, which made it possible to install the pulley without using the key (what is a key, I will explain later).

Since I had too wide pulley in stock, I decided to use large clamping washers that usually fasten the saw by turning one back side so that a wedge-shaped wedge is. I found that the space between them is too narrow, and to expand it, put the lock washer between them. The advantage in this method is that the clamping washers have a flat edge, which is fixed with a flat edge for simultaneous rotation with the core.

Belt

I used the drive belt 7 x 500 mm. You can use a standard 12 mm, but thin more flexible, and it will load the motor less. He does not need to rotate the grinding wheel.

Construction of a ribbon grinder

The device is simple. The electric motor drives the belt that rotates the "main" pulley of 10 x 5 cm, which leads to the movement of abrasive tape. Another pulley of 8 x 5 cm is located 40 cm above the main and 15 cm at the back and fastened on the bearing. The third 8 x 5 cm pulley rotates on the lever, and acts as a tensioning roller, tightly holding the abrasive ribbon. On the other side, the spruce lever is attached to the frame.

Determining the type of drive

The main issue was to rotate the main pulley directly by the electric motor or using an additional pulley and drive belt. First of all, I chose a belt transmission because I wanted to have the opportunity to replace the engine to more powerful, however, there was another reason. When you produce intensive metal processing, there is a risk to face some problems. The belt transmission in such cases will slip, while the direct drive will create big problems. With a belt, the device will be safer.

Making rollers for grinding machine

I made rollers from several segments of solid rocks with a thickness of 2.5 cm. But you can use MDF, Paneur or other material. When laying the layers, it is necessary to do so that the fibers are perpendicular to, it will give the rollers additional strength and layers will not split.

It is necessary to make three rollers: main roller, upper roller and tensioning roller. The main roller is made of two 13 x 13 cm of pieces with a thickness of 2.5 cm. Upper and tensioning rollers from two pieces of wood with a size of 10 x 10 cm.

Process:
Start from gluing a pair of 13 cm and 10 cm pieces of wood, closing them with clamps. After drying the glue, cut the corners with the help of a tracing saw, then find the center of each part. Secure them in the lathe and process until their dimensions become 5 x 10 cm and 5 x 8 cm.

Upper and tensioning rollers:
Next, you need to install bearings in rollers with a size of 5 x 8 cm. Select a crown or first drill, and drill the recess to the bearing width. The internal bearing ring should rotate freely, so you need to drill a hole passing through the roller through the inner ring of the bearing. This will allow the bolt to pass through with the minimum hole.

Main Roller:
This item is done a little differently. There are no bearings on it, however, if the shaft leaves the roller less than 5 cm, you will need to run the roller in width. Measure the diameter of the shaft and in the center of the roller you need to drill the same hole. Try inserting the shaft, it should hold hard, otherwise the roller will shake.

Tension lever

The lever is made of a metal plate with a size of 10 x 30 x 200 mm with rounded edges. It is necessary to drill quite large holes in it, so I recommend using a drilling machine and a lot of lubrication for this. Most need 4 holes. The first at the point of rotation. It is not in the center of the plank, but by 8 cm from its edge. The second hole will be on the edge, close to the point of rotation. It will serve for fastening the spring. Two additional holes need to be drilled at the opposite end, approximately 5 cm from each other. They should be slightly wider in diameter, as they will be used to configure, which I will tell further.

When all the holes are made, you can fix the shoulder at a vertical corner between the top roller and the basis. The end on which the spring will be attached towards the main roller. He must rotate freely, so I recommend using two nuts for fastening, the main twisting is not completely, and the second is used as a lock nut.

Stabilization of ribbon

Wearings for rollers or uneven surfaces can lead to the fact that during operation the abrasive tape will gradually go with them. A stabilizing device is a device on a tensioning roller, which allows it to be at an angle that ensures the retention of the abrasive tape in the center. Its device is much easier than it looks, and consists of a fixing bolt, a bit of the free stroke of the tensioner and an adjusting bolt.

Drilling holes in bolts:
For this purpose, I made a device, in the form of a wedge-shaped cutout in a board, which will help at the time of drilling to hold the bolt in place. You can do this and manually, but I do not recommend.

Fixing bolt.

A fixing bolt is a simple bolt with a hole drilled in it, and which is installed on the bar through a wide hole, which is closer to the point of rotation of the lever. Since it is located between the lever and the roller, its head needs to be drowning so that it does not pin it. The bolt must be fixed as shown in the figure.

Bolt on which the roller is attached

It needs to relax a bit so that the tension roller has a small backlash. But so that it does not spin, you need to make a crown nut. To do this, you just need to make cuts on the edges of the usual nut so that it looks like a crown. In the bolt itself there will be two drilled holes: one for an adjusting bolt, and it will be aligned with a hole with a locking bolt, and another for fixing the crown nut with a pin.

Bolt for setting:
After the tensioning roller is put in its place, you can install a regulating bolt that will pass through the holes of the locking bolt and the bolt on which the tension roller rotates. The system works when you delay the adjusting bolt, forcing the axis of rotation of the tensioning roller to shift the angle of rotation outward, thus forcing the tape tends to the mechanism. Spring from the other end of the lever adjusts the tension in the opposite direction. I recommend consuming the adjusting bolt with locknut, as vibrations can weaken it.

Grinding process

Grinding is the process of removing the upper layer from the surface of the processed part using the use of abrasives or diamond crumbs. They are assembled in the total mass on the working surface and is bonded by the binder. They form a grinding wheel or ribbon as a result.

During the operation of the abrasive surface there is a circular motion using an electric motor. When contacting the surface of the blank with an abrasive and the processing process takes place. There is a commodity opinion that grinding abrasives is friction treatment. However, it is incorrect.

Each abrasive particle has sharp edges when touched with the material (metal, plastic, wood, stone) works like a cutting tool and removes chips, how to say the cutter or drill. How is the ribbon grinder going with her own hands? The tape is tensioning between two shafts or drum rollers. One of which is the presenter (it is attached to the engine spindle), and the second is the slave (it ensures the tension of the grinding tape). For the tape did not score from the drums, the washers-stops are attached to their ends. It turns out something like a textile coil. With minor skews, the tape wear occurs faster than the edges of the ribbon rubbing on the lock washers are destroyed. So this idea is quite viable and justifies itself.

Also between the drums from the back of the tape, the support screen is installed, which provides a dense clamp of the entire plane of the billet to the surface of the tape. To reduce the strength of friction, the screen is thoroughly polished. It is possible to make it from both light metal and solid wood.

Leading roller must be cut or made from rigid rubber. This will ensure the impossibility of slipping the tape over the surface of the roller. The whole design can be positioned differently: vertically, horizontally or at an angle. To the shared bed, as well as on all similar machines, the girlfriend is fastened, at an angle of 90 degrees, or adjustable. The distance between the ribbon and the edge of the girlfriend should not be more than 3 mm. Due to the fact that the tape break is not able to cause significant injuries, protection is made only to remove grinding products.
